Grindstone Island, Qc vs Puerto Cabezas Climate & Distance Between

Nicaragua flag
  • The distance between Grindstone Island, Qc, Canada and Puerto Cabezas, Nicaragua is approximately 4,217 km or 2,620 mi.
  • To reach Grindstone Island, Qc in this distance one would set out from Puerto Cabezas bearing 24.1°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Grindstone Island, Qc bearing 35.8° or NE .
  • Grindstone Island, Qc has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Puerto Cabezas has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am).
  • The mean annual temperature is 21.9 °C (39.4°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 21.5 °C (38.7°F) more in Grindstone Island, Qc.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 1811.8 mm (71.3 in) less which is equivalent to 1811.8 l/m² (44.47 US gal/ft²) or 18,118,000 l/ha (1,936,934 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 29.6° lower in Grindstone Island, Qc than in Puerto Cabezas.
